Robert Wayne
Hoover
March 6, 1944 – April 6, 2020
Robert Wayne Hoover, 76, of Nashville, died Monday April 6, 2020 at his residence in Seminole, FL.
He was born March 6, 1944 in Irvine, KY to the late Robert P. Hoover and the late Bertha Gray Hoover. He was a retired Master Sergeant United States Air Force with 22 years of service. He also was a retired HVAC technician with the Berrien County Board of Education and worked for Prestolite in Tifton. He was of the Baptist faith, served in Vietnam, member of the Nashville Post VFW and a member of the Disabled American Veterans. He was preceded in death by a sister: Armitta Hoover.
He is survived by his wife: Carolyn Hudson Hoover of Nashville ; 2 daughters: Danitta (Shannon) Downey of Seminole, FL and Pamela (Seab) Temples of Valdosta; step daughter: April Wetherington of Tifton; sister: Loretta Walters of Ohio; 4 grandchildren: Ryan (Elizabeth) Downey of Largo, FL, Rileigh Downey of Largo, FL, Zach Temples of Valdosta and Tyler Temples of Valdosta; step granddaughter: Amanda Coody of Valdosta; 2 step grandsons: Dakota Flanders of Tifton and Brandon Flanders of Nashville; several brothers-in-law, sisters-in-law, nieces and nephews.
The family will have a private graveside funeral service on Saturday April 11, 2020 in the Nashville Memorial Gardens with Rev. Mike Bennett officiating.
